Carmelo Hayes thinks his NXT class with Bron Breakker & Trick Williams will "change the game" in WWE much like Roman Reigns, Seth Rollins and Big E did over a decade ago, and John Cena, Randy Orton & Brock Lesnar did in the early 2000s:"I think every 10 years you see a group of guys come in and change the game. I was comparing it at one point to when Roman (Reigns), Seth (Rollins), Big E and all that crop of guys came through and changed the game in that era, Daniel Bryan. "10 years before that when it was Randy (Orton), (John) Cena, (Brock) Lesnar, Shelton (Benjamin), that whole class and that boom era of the Ruthless Aggression era. "Every 10 years or so you get that crop of guys and I believe we’re that crop of guys for that modern era."
 


Carmelo Hayes says The Miz is a "necessary" person to have around and helped him get through a low point in his WWE career:"He’s necessary, if that makes sense. He’s a necessary person to have around. "I remember at one point, despite whatever we have on storyline wise, I just said, ‘Thank you bro for being here, I’m so happy you’re here.’ I just had to tell him that, I was like, ‘I’m just so happy I’m here and you’re here at the same time and I’m getting to learn from you.’ "Because there’s a lot of times where I was feeling low. Like I don’t know what’s going on and the only person that’s been able to explain it to me has been The Miz, because he’s been high, he’s been low, he’s been in the middle. He’s done it so many times. "He gave me a great quote, some advice, he said, ‘When you’re at the top it’s gonna be easy because you figured out how to manage at the bottom.’ I was like ‘Dang, that’s so true.’ He was like 'Yeah just wait, everybody gets a turn.' In a way, not everybody gets their turn but when you’re good you’re gonna get chosen at some point right?"
